Course content

The course begins with team dynamics under pressure.

Participants explore how roles, hierarchy and authority gradients affect communication, challenge and coordination. We look at how steep gradients can stop people speaking up and how too little structure can create confusion about who is responsible for what.

From there, the course looks at what makes teams effective. This includes shared goals, shared understanding and shared ways of working, alongside practical ideas drawn from group dynamics, psychological safety, accountability and performance standards. The focus is not just on helping people feel safe, but on helping teams speak openly, challenge well and still hold high standards.

Participants look at common decision traps, the risks of groupthink and deference to authority and the importance of creating enough clarity and flexibility for teams to respond intelligently when pressure rises.

Participants leave with a clearer understanding of how team resilience can be strengthened through clearer roles, better communication, stronger cooperation, practical decision making and more deliberate ways of working under pressure.

Team resilience as a skillset

It is often assumed that bringing together intelligent, skilled people will naturally produce a high-performing team. In practice, that overlooks the human factors that shape how teams communicate, coordinate, make decisions and perform when pressure rises.

Team resilience depends on the conditions that allow people to work well together under strain. Shared goals, clear roles, common language, mutual trust and effective communication all matter, along with enough clarity and flexibility for people to respond intelligently as situations change.

Where those conditions are weak, pressure exposes bottlenecks, key person dependencies, poor coordination and reactive decision making. Small problems become harder to contain and teams can slip into workarounds that solve the immediate issue while creating risk elsewhere. Where they are stronger, teams are better able to maintain standards, support one another and learn from disruption rather than simply firefighting through it.
